Latest Patents

Among his most recent patents, Bramley has developed groundbreaking technologies including "Disabling Software Persistence" and "System Management Memory Coherency Detection." The "Disabling Software Persistence" patent outlines a computing device that can discern during the booting process whether the operating system in use is a primary one. If it detects a non-primary operating system that doesn’t meet certain criteria, it effectively disables software persistence, enhancing system security. Meanwhile, the "System Management Memory Coherency Detection" patent involves a firmware controller that manages system execution modes and identifies discrepancies in memory processes, which is crucial for maintaining system integrity.
